How do I select input on Samsung Smart TV?

Selecting input on a Samsung Smart TV is a fairly straightforward and intuitive process. Depending on the model of TV, there are several different options for selecting input.

On many Samsung Smart TVs, there is a button along the side or top of the TV labeled “Input” or “Source”. You can simply press this button to cycle through your various input devices. The input device you have currently selected will appear on the TV’s display.

You can also select the input using the Smart Remote that came with the TV. Look for the button labeled “Source” or “Input” and press this button. A list of all the connected devices will appear. Navigate up and down to highlight the device you want to select and press the OK/Select button to choose the input.

If your Samsung Smart TV is part of the Samsung Smart Touch Control range, you can use the Samsung Smart Touch remote to select the input at the bottom of the remote. Using the navigation ring, select the Input option, and cycle through the list of connected devices to select the required input.

Finally, you can also select the input using the on-screen Universal Guide. Press the Guide Button on your remote, and then select the Source button. Here, you can select from a list of connected devices and select the required input.

How do I change input on Samsung TV without remote?

If your Samsung TV remote is lost or not working, there are several ways you can still change the input on your TV.

1. Use the Buttons on the TV: Many Samsung TV’s have physical buttons on the back or the right or left side of the TV that can be used to access the Input menu. Depending on your model of TV, you’ll find buttons labeled ‘Source’, ‘Input’, ‘TV/Video’, and/or ‘Menu’.

Pressing a combination of these buttons can open up the Input menu, allowing you to cycle through and select a different input.

2. Download the Samsung Smart Things App: The Samsung Smart Things App is available for both Android and iOS devices and it is a great way to control and adjust settings on your TV without a remote. Additionally, you can use it to change the input on your Samsung TV.

3. Buy a Universal Remote: If none of the above options are available to you, you can also buy a universal remote and program it to work with your Samsung TV. All you need is the TV model number, which can usually be found on the back of the TV.

Once you’ve selected one of the above methods to control your Samsung TV without a remote, you should be able to easily change the input and still enjoy your favorite programs.

Why is my Samsung TV not recognize HDMI input?

There could potentially be multiple reasons why your Samsung TV is not recognizing the HDMI input. The first thing you should check is the HDMI cable connection between your TV and the device. Make sure that the HDMI port you are using is securely connected on both ends and that the HDMI cable is in good condition.

You should also ensure that both your Samsung TV and the device you are connecting it to, such as a DVD player, cable box, or gaming console, are turned on and functioning properly. If you are connecting multiple devices to the TV, make sure all devices are turned on and connected to the correct ports of your television.

It is also possible that the source you are using is not compatible with the TV or it doesn’t meet the necessary specifications. If this is the case, you may need to switch to a different source device or adjust the settings on the one you are currently using.

You should also confirm that the correct source is selected on your Samsung TV. To do so, select the “Source” option on your TV’s remote, and find the HDMI source you want to use. If there is only one HDMI port on your TV, it may just be automatically selected.

Finally, if you are still unable to get the HDMI input recognized on your Samsung TV, you may have a hardware issue with the TV or device. Contact the manufacturer for assistance or try connecting the device to a different television if possible.

How can I use my phone as a remote for my Samsung TV?

Using your phone as a remote for your Samsung TV is quite simple! All you need to do is install the Samsung SmartThings app on your smartphone. Once you have that done, you will need to connect your phone to the same Wi-Fi network as your TV.

Once connected, open the Samsung SmartThings app and select the “Remote Control” option from the main menu.

From there, you will be able to control the volume, switch between channels, access menu settings and even use the virtual keyboard to type in text. Depending on the TV model, you may also be able to access third-party apps, such as Netflix and Amazon Prime Video, right from your phone.

To make the connection even simpler and more convenient for you, you can also set up detection for your TV and the app will automatically switch settings from your phone to the TV whenever you launch it.

Overall, using your phone as a remote for your Samsung TV is a quick and easy way to get more control over your TV viewing experience.

How do you connect your phone to a Samsung TV?

Connecting your phone to a Samsung TV is fairly straightforward.

First, make sure your TV is powered on, and then connect your phone to the same wireless network as the TV. Then open the Smart View app on your device. This will scan for nearby TV’s and should show the Samsung model you own.

Once you’ve found your model, tap it to connect. On your phone, you’ll be prompted to give permission for Smart View to access your device. Once this permission is granted, the TV will display a code.

You need to enter this code in the Smart View app on your phone to connect it.

Once your device is connected, you can then select the content you’d like to play on the TV, and share photos, videos, music and more. To disconnect, simply open the Smart View app again, then select ‘Disconnect’ from the bottom menu.

How do you fix my TV when it says no signal?

If your television is showing the message “no signal,” it’s likely that either the TV is not receiving any signal from the source (such as a cable box or antenna), or there is an issue with your source or the connection between your source and TV.

First, check that your source is working properly. If you’re using an antenna, ensure it’s securely and properly connected to your TV. If you’re using a cable or satellite box, make sure it’s powered on, as well as any connections between the box and TV.

If you’re using an A/V receiver and external speakers, ensure it’s powered on, as well as any connections between the receiver, external speakers, and TV.

If your source is properly connected and powered on but you’re still seeing the “no signal” message, try changing the channel or video input on your TV to match the connection type for the source. For example, if the source is connected via HDMI, then you should change your TV’s video input selection to the HDMI port connected to the source.

Lastly, if you’re still having issues, double-check all of your source’s cables to make sure they’re firmly connected to both the source and your TV. If the cables are securely connected and you’ve already tried changing your TV’s video input selection, then it’s likely the cable is at fault and you’ll need to purchase a new one.
